Understanding the Toilet Renovation Process

The process of renovating a toilet in an HDB flat can seem overwhelming, but understanding the steps involved can make it manageable. Here’s a breakdown of the typical toilet renovation process:

1. Planning and Design

Before starting any renovation project, it's crucial to have a well-thought-out plan. This phase includes:

  • Setting a Budget: Determine how much you want to spend on the renovation.
  • Design Inspiration: Gather inspiration from magazines, websites, and social media platforms to visualize your desired look.
  • Consultation with Professionals: Collaborate with experienced renovation contractors like Sk Renovation Contractors Singapore to determine feasibility and options.

2. Demolition and Preparation

Once the design is finalized, the next step is the demolition phase, which may involve:

  • Removing old fixtures (toilets, sinks, bathtubs)
  • Taking out tiles or flooring
  • Repairing any plumbing issues that may be present

3. Installation

With the old fixtures removed, the exciting part begins! The installation phase often includes:

  • Installing new plumbing fixtures, such as sinks, toilets, and showers
  • Applying floor and wall tiles according to the design plan
  • Installing cabinets and storage solutions

4. Finishing Touches

The final phase involves adding all the little details that make the space stand out. This includes:

  • Lighting fixtures that enhance the space
  • Decorative elements such as mirrors and towel racks
  • Storage solutions such as shelving or cabinets

Choosing the Right Materials for Your Toilet Renovation

Selecting the right materials is crucial for both aesthetics and durability. Here are some popular choices:

Tiles

Tiles are a popular choice for toilets due to their water resistance and ease of maintenance. Options include:

  • Ceramic Tiles: Durable and available in various colors and patterns.
  • Porcelain Tiles: Not only stylish but also very robust.
  • Vinyl Tiles: Budget-friendly and available in a range of designs.

Sanitary Fixtures

Choosing the right sanitary fixtures can elevate your bathroom's appearance. Consider:

  • Water-saving Toilets: Conserve water while providing efficient flush performance.
  • Contemporary Sinks: Available in various styles and materials, ranging from ceramic to glass.
  • Walk-in Showers: Stylish and functional, adding a touch of luxury.

Common Challenges in Toilet Renovation HDB

While renovating your toilet can be a rewarding project, it’s essential to be aware of potential challenges you may encounter:

Space Constraints

HDB toilets often come with limited space, which can be challenging when trying to incorporate all desired elements. Utilizing smart storage solutions can maximize your space effectively.

Budget Overruns

It’s not uncommon for renovation projects to exceed the initial budget. Planning for unexpected expenses while maintaining effective communication with your contractor can help mitigate this risk.

Regulations and Approvals

In Singapore, certain renovations may require approvals from the HDB or other authorities. It's crucial to understand these guidelines to avoid penalties and ensure compliance.

Cost of Toilet Renovation in HDB Flats

The cost of renovating a toilet in an HDB flat can vary greatly depending on various factors, including:

  • Size of the Toilet: Larger bathrooms typically require more materials and labor.
  • Choice of Materials: High-end materials come with a higher price tag.
  • Complexity of Design: Intricate designs may require more time and expertise to execute.

On average, you can expect to spend anywhere from SGD $5,000 to SGD $15,000 on a complete toilet renovation, but prices can vary widely based on the specifics of your project.
